Default RE: Consistancy and Shooting

Practice, practice, and more practice. I have been shooting over 20 years and when I get out of practice, it takes a good amount of time to get it back. It would also be helpful if you have someone watch you so they can see if you are keeping things consistant. If you are a new shooter, it might take years to get good consistant groups. Just keep your head up, and when you get frustrated, put it up. More bad habits are developed after a person gets frustrated and keeps shooting.
